À quoi sert le mappage de l'URL?
Prenez un exemple plus pratique, par exemple, vous développez un site Web de blog, et l'adresse de chargement de chaque page d'accueil du blog est
www.blog.com/default.aspx?id=anckly
La page par défaut sélectionne le contenu du blog de l'utilisateur correspondant via l'ID, mais vous avez besoin de vos utilisateurs pour entrer www.blog.com/anckly pour accéder à son blog. À l'heure actuelle, vous pouvez utiliser le mappage d'URL dans ASP.NET2.0 pour réaliser cet effet.
Le principe de l'implémentation est de configurer le mappage de l'URL en configurant le fichier Web.config du site Web.
<! - Mappage d'URL->
<Urlmappings activé = true>
<Ajouter url = ~ / anckly mapedUrl = ~ / default.aspx?
</ Urlmappings>
L'étape suivante consiste à définir le chemin de mappage.
De retour à la première question, vous pouvez ajouter un nœud Ajouter aux URLMappings après que chaque utilisateur enregistré (veuillez vous référer à System.Configuration Noming Space) pour stocker le chemin de mappage de l'URL de chaque utilisateur.
Une autre utilisation du mappage URL consiste à masquer le chemin de la page Web réel et à fournir une certaine garantie de sécurité pour le site Web.